Close ad

Tungod kay ang presentasyon kagahapon mao ang pag-abli sa developer conference WWDC 2016, kini usa ka dako nga gibug-aton sa bag-ong mga posibilidad alang sa mga developers. Sa pagtapos sa presentasyon, gipresentar usab sa Apple ang kaugalingon nga plano aron mapadako ang gidaghanon sa mga tawo nga nakasabut sa mga sinultian sa programming.

Gusto niini nga buhaton sa tabang sa usa ka bag-ong iPad app nga gitawag Swift Playgrounds. Tudloan niini ang mga tiggamit niini sa pagsabut ug pagtrabaho kauban ang Swift programming language, nga gimugna sa Apple ug kaniadtong 2014. gipagawas isip open source, busa magamit sa tanan ug walay bayad.

Atol sa live nga presentasyon, ang usa sa unang mga leksyon nga itanyag sa aplikasyon gipakita. Ang dula gipakita sa tuo nga katunga sa display, ang mga panudlo sa wala. Ang aplikasyon niining puntoha sa pagkatinuod nagkinahanglan lamang sa tiggamit sa pagdula sa dula - apan imbes sa mga graphical nga kontrol, kini naggamit sa mga linya sa code nga giaghat.

Niining paagiha, makakat-on sila sa pag-operate sa mga batakang konsepto sa Swift, sama sa mga sugo, mga gimbuhaton, mga galong, mga parameter, mga variable, operator, mga tipo, ug uban pa. sa mga hagit nga makapalalom sa abilidad sa pagtrabaho uban sa nahibal-an na nga mga konsepto.

Bisan pa, ang pagkat-on sa Swift Playgrounds wala mohunong sa mga sukaranan, nga gipakita sa Apple programmer gamit ang panig-ingnan sa usa ka kaugalingon nga gibuhat nga dula diin ang pisika sa kalibutan gikontrol gamit ang gyroscope sa iPad.

Tungod kay ang iPad walay pisikal nga keyboard, ang Apple nakamugna og daghang palette sa mga kontrol. Ang "classic" software QWERTY keyboard mismo, pananglitan, dugang sa code whisperer, adunay daghang mga karakter sa indibidwal nga mga yawe nga gipili sa lainlaing mga lahi sa interaksyon sa kanila (pananglitan, usa ka numero ang gisulat pinaagi sa pag-drag sa yawe pataas).

Ang kanunay nga gigamit nga mga elemento sa code dili kinahanglan nga isulat, i-drag lang kini gikan sa usa ka espesyal nga menu ug i-drag pag-usab aron mapili ang hanay sa code kung diin kini kinahanglan i-apply. Human sa pag-tap sa usa ka numero, ang numeric keypad lang ang makita sa ibabaw niini.

Ang nabuhat nga mga proyekto mahimong ipaambit ingon nga mga dokumento nga adunay extension .playground ug bisan kinsa nga adunay iPad ug ang Swift Playgrounds nga aplikasyon nga na-install makahimo sa pag-abli ug pag-edit niini. Ang mga proyekto nga gihimo sa kini nga format mahimo usab nga ma-import sa Xcode (ug vice versa).

Sama sa tanan nga gipaila sa presentasyon kagahapon, ang Swift Playgrounds magamit na karon sa developer, nga ang una nga pagsulay sa publiko moabut sa Hulyo ug ang pagpagawas sa publiko sa tingdagdag, kauban ang iOS 10. Ang tanan mahimong libre.

.